- Pneumatic Spring
The passive isolators on a ScienceDesk consist of an air chamber with a rolling-rubber sidewall. The air chamber is connected by tubing to a Schrader valve so that once the air chamber is inflated, the source of compressed air or the pump used to pressurize the chamber can be removed. The optical tabletop is supported by the air pressure in the chamber, which can be adjusted to compensate for a change in the load supported by the system. The volume and stiffness of the reinforced rubber air chamber has been optimized to minimize the resonant frequency of the optical table supports while maximizing the damping performance. The optical tabletop is supported by rigid supports when the passive isolators are not inflated. ScienceDesks with passive isolators are the most frequently chosen ScienceDesk for imaging applications. The level of isolation provided by the passive isolators provides an ideal environment for optical, OCT, confocal, and other imaging systems without the need for a constant supply of regulated compressed air. The compact frame supports a family of accessories that allow for the creation of an ergonomic workstation for imaging applications. For instance, a Swept Source OCT Imaging System contains the optical scan head as well as a computer, monitor, swept source laser, and a control box. With the ScienceDesk, all of the supporting electronics can be easily situated around the isolated optical tabletop without transmitting the vibrations created by the cooling fans.
